I have the IRO doubel shear up front and it is pure beef. Perfect for 3.5" of lift and can be adjusted back to stock height if you need it to be. Rear I would go with IRO if you get their front, but JKS otherwise
In the front I have KOR TB conversion, which is basically the JKS bar made especially for KOR.
Whatever you do, you should get the conversion kit for the front. IRO double shear or KOR. KOR is a bit pricey but it comes now with these incredibly hard bushings that give the bar zero play.
